Blinker problem
Well we just put a new radiator in my 00 Cherokee limited and when I drove it and used my right turn signal it blinks about 2x the speed normally... The left one blinks fine..... All 3 lights are working for the blinker.... Any thoughts?

I had a corroded socket in one of the two-bulb front turn units. Both lamps worked fine for marker lights, but only one blinked as a turn signal. Had to disassemble the socket to see the corroded open circuit.
I've read here many of these grounds are under the driver's side interior rear panel behind the spare tire. If you have trailer hitch wiring installed, you'll have more places to look.
